  • WT5”BZ] To evaluate the effect of Insulin resistance and secreting function on glucose metabolism of patients with cirrhosis, 30 cirrhosis patients and 26 controls were enrolled in the OGTT and insulin releasing test.IR derived from Homa model and HBCI were used for result analysis. Significant reduction in OGTT was observed while a rise in IR and HBCI was found in cirrhosis group compared with control group (P<0 01) .Serum insulin level was increased and insulin release was delayed in patients group.There exist insulin resistance, hepatogenous glucose tolerance impairment, endogenous hyperinsulinemia and insulin releasing delay in cirrhosis patients, which is considered to be associated with hepatonic dysfunction.
